TikTok slideshows (photo carousels with a song underneath) are one of the fastest-growing formats on the platform, but the native app gives you no way to export them as a single file. You can screenshot the images one at a time and lose the music, or you can use StashTik and get the whole slideshow as one MP4 with the audio already mixed in.

The flow is identical to downloading a regular TikTok video. Paste the link once and StashTik detects the slideshow, then offers you both a bundled MP4 and individual full-resolution photos on the same result page.

Step 1: Copy the slideshow link

Open the slideshow in TikTok, tap the Share arrow, then choose Copy link. The same Copy link button works for photo posts and video posts.

Step 2: Paste it into StashTik

Open stashtik.com on your phone or computer and paste the URL into the input. StashTik reads the link, sees that it's a slideshow, and loads the preview with every download option that makes sense.

Step 3: Choose Photos + Audio or All Images

Tap Photos + Audio to get the whole carousel as one MP4 with the song mixed in — perfect for reposting or sending on WhatsApp. Tap All Images to get a ZIP of every photo at full resolution instead.

  • Photos + Audio exports the carousel as one MP4 with the song mixed in.
  • All Images gives you a ZIP of every photo at full resolution.
  • You can also tap any individual thumbnail to save a single image.
  • Works on iPhone, Android, Mac and PC with no app install.
